The reason I want to buy from this shop, even if it's a little more expensive than Amazon.

Yesterday, I placed an order for some guitar wiring material that seemed a bit rare.

What I ordered was some vintage wiring material from Siemens.

Then today, I received a shipping notification email from Mr. Hatano at VWD21 SHOP.

Of course, it was a shipping notification, but it wasn't a robotic, automated-style message; it was a very polite email. Well, it might have been automated, though 💦

Well, it was just that simple thing.

But it made me think, 'I'm glad I bought from this shop.'

Amazon is convenient.

I use it almost every day, too.

Shipping is fast, and the prices are low.

It's not rare for things I want to arrive the very next day.

So, I have no intention of criticizing Amazon at all.

In fact, it's an essential part of my life now.

But when it comes to guitar parts and gear, it's a little different.

Of course, price is important.

But 'who I buy from' matters just as much to me.

It was the same when I bought my G5230T.

It was precisely because of my interactions with Mura-chan from Sumiya Goody that that guitar became more than just a used instrument.

The Concert II is the same.

I bought that on Mura-chan's recommendation, and having it repaired by Mr. Nishida at THE AMP SHOP made it an amp I'm even more attached to.

I'm sure this Siemens wiring material will end up being the same way.

Wiring material isn't visible once it's inside a guitar.

You probably won't think, 'This is all thanks to this wiring!' while you're playing.

Even so, the memory of 'I bought this from this person' remains.

If we're talking only about price, there might be cheaper shops out there.

I'm sure there are wiring materials with better cost performance, too.

But if I can have a pleasant shopping experience for just a few hundred yen more, that's what I'd choose.

Even now, when online shopping has become the norm, human-to-human interaction still remains.

In fact, perhaps that's exactly why a single email can leave such an impression.

Recently, I've been writing more articles recommending products on Amazon.

But at the same time, I think about this.

The things I want to buy on Amazon are different from the things I want to buy from a person.

It's not a question of which one is right.

Both have their own merits.

I will continue to use Amazon.

But for things I'll be using for a long time, like guitars and gear, I want to cherish the shopping experiences where I can feel, 'I'm glad I bought this from this person.'

The wiring material hasn't arrived yet.

But I'm looking forward to it just a little bit more now.

That's not because it's Siemens wiring, but because it's wiring I bought from Mr. Hatano at TMD VWD21 SHOP.
